Attributed to Pietro Antonio Rotari (1707 - 1762), Italian painter of the Rococo era. His portraits, mostly of women, are renowned for being beautiful and realistic. The details and skill with which this portrait was painted are admirable. A young noble girl sits in a thoughtful pose, leaning on the back of a chair. She is wearing a riding camisole, light blue with gold embroidered details. The camisole is a little loose, her face is a little flushed... this tells us that the girl is resting after horseback riding. On her we see an expensive pearl set consisting of a necklace and earrings and a gold ring with a sapphire; all the jewelry is very harmoniously combined with her clothes and does not give the impression of pretentious pomposity. There is a coquettish hair clip in her hair in the form of a bouquet of fresh flowers. Antique oil painting on canvas, unsigned, framed, first half of the 18th century.
Size app.: 72.5 x 57 cm (roughly 28.5 x 22.4 in) frame 84.5 x 69.6 cm (roughly 33.3 x 27.4 in). Pietro Antonio Rotari was born in Verona, he led a peripatetic career, and died in Saint Petersburg, where he had traveled to paint for the Russian Imperial court. Rotari's was initially a pupil of Antonio Balestra, but moved and lived in Venice from 1725 to 1727. He then joined the studio of Francesco Trevisani in Rome (1728–1732). Between 1731 and 1734, he worked with Francesco Solimena in Naples. He then returned then to Verona, where he started a studio. In 1750, he moved to Vienna. In 1756, he was invited to Russia by the court of the Tsarina Elizabetta Petrovna. From there he moved to Dresden and to work with the court of Augustus III of Poland. He returned to St Petersburg to work with the court of Catherine II. Portrait of King Augustus III of Poland, by Rotari, 1750s. He was much in demand as a portraitist, and painted royal families in Dresden and Saint Petersburg. He also painted the multi-figured altarpieces of the Four Martyrs (1745) for the church of the Ospedale di San Giacomo in Verona. He also painted an altarpiece of San Giorgio tempted to sacricifice to the Idols (1743) for the church of the same name in Reggio-Emilia, and an Annunciation (1738) for the main altar for the church of the Annunziata in Guastalla. After the death of Rotari in 1762, Empress Catherine II bought all the canvases that remained in his studio from the artist's widow for 14,000 rubles. In total, there were about six hundred portraits. Catherine II decided to decorate one of the halls of the Grand Palace in Peterhof with Rotari “girls' heads”. In 1764, according to the project of the architect J. B. Vallin-Delamote, the “trellis” (solid) hanging of paintings in the hall, called the “Cabinet of Fashion and Graces”, was completed. Wallin-Delamote designed the frames and reduced the number of portraits to 368 in the final version.

Matthew William Peters (1742-1814) was an English portrait and genre painter who later became an Anglican clergyman and chaplain to George IV. He became known as "William" when he started signing his works as "W. Peters". Peters was born in Freshwater, Isle of Wight, the son of Matthew Peters (born at Belfast, 1711), a civil engineer and member of the Royal Dublin Society; by Elizabeth, the eldest daughter of George Younge of Dublin. The family moved from England to Dublin when Peters was young. Peters received his artistic training from Robert West in Dublin; in 1756 and 1758 he received prizes from the first School of Design in Dublin. In 1759, he was sent by the Dublin Society to London to become a student of Thomas Hudson and won a premium from the Society of Arts. The group also paid for him to travel to Italy to study art from 1761 to 1765. On 23 September 1762 he was elected to the Accademia del Disegno in Florence. Peters returned to England in 1765 and exhibited works at the Society of Artists from 1766 to 1769. Beginning in 1769, Peters exhibited works at the Royal Academy. In 1771 he was elected an associate and in 1777 an academician. He returned to Italy in 1771 and stayed until 1775. He also probably traveled to Paris in 1783–84, where he met Léopold Boilly, Antoine Vestier, and was influenced by the work of Jean-Baptiste Greuze. On 27 February 1769, Peters became a freemason, and he was made the grand portrait painter of the Freemasons and the first provincial grand master of Lincolnshire in 1792. In 1785, he exhibited portraits of the Duke of Manchester and Lord Petre as Grand Master at the Royal Academy exhibition. According to Robin Simon's article in the Oxford Dictionary of National Biography, no British contemporary had such an Italian manner of painting as Peters, reflecting the old masters he copied. Many of Peters' works were erotic and although these works did not damage his career, according to Simon, Peters later regretted these when he became an ordained clergyman in 1781. He served as the Royal Academy's chaplain from 1784 to 1788, at which time he resigned to become chaplain to the Prince of Wales. In 1784, Peters was awarded the living of Scalford, Leicestershire by Charles Manners, 4th Duke of Rutland.
